Author, founder and president of Quiet Time Ministries Catherine Martin enthusiastically writes, speaks, and teaches devotion to God through His Word. In her new book, she presents the many names of God, describes how they reveal His character, and explains that by trusting in them readers can better understand who God is. Whether it's read in order, by topic, or devotionally over 30 days, readers learn tomake better decisions in their daily livesrespond more courageously to trials and adverse circumstancestrust God rather than people, money, and possessionsIndividuals, casual groups of friends, church congregations, and even families looking for a meaningful daily devotion will all find this book and its discussion questions a compelling invitation to wholeheartedly seek God and trust in His every name.Also available: Trusting in the Name of God--Quiet Time Experience and Trusting in the Names of God DVD.

We often form an opinion of people the first time we meet them. at was surely the case when I first met Catherine Martin 20 years ago. She had matriculated at Bethel Seminary San Diego and had enrolled in one of my courses. Although the class was large—it was required of all entering stu-dents—she stood out from the rest primarily because of her glowing smile. Always cheerful and lively, she reminded me a bit of Katie Couric. Come to think of it, I can’t ever remember seeing Catherine when she didn’t have a smile on her face. As it turned out, she had much more than just a bubbly personality. She quickly demonstrated the diligent and systematically determined side of her nature as she waltzed through all three of my courses in which she had enrolled. ose who know Catherine will not be surprised to learn that she earned an A in each of them—effortlessly, as nearly as I could gauge. It soon became clear that she was an exceptional student, concluding her formal education at Bethel with a 4.0 GPA and graduating summa cum laude with a master of arts degree in theological studies. Catherine’s ministry in the service of Christ began long before she came to Bethel. She had worked for Josh McDowell and Bill Bright for sev-eral years, and she served as a women’s Bible-study leader for more than a decade, including during her time as a seminary student. It was only natu-ral, then, that she should found and direct an organization such as Quiet Time Ministries soon after graduation. Growing up in Chicago as a young Christian, I was advised by my spiri-tual mentors to spend a quiet time every day with my Lord. at meant that I was to read my Bible and pray every day—a worthy and important spiritual exercise. Some years ago I discovered that the phrases “quiet time” and “Catherine Martin” are virtual synonyms—or at least they are closely associated with each other in the minds of many people.
